Battery and electric equipment
By introducing a safety component consisting of a first temperature switch and a resistor into the lithium-ion battery, the problem of thermal runaway in lithium-ion batteries under high temperature or high power is solved, enabling automatic discharge and heat dissipation in high-temperature environments and improving battery safety.

[0001] The present application relates to the technical field of new energy, in particular to a battery and an electric device provided with the battery. BACKGROUND
[0002] In the field of batteries, especially lithium ion batteries, due to high energy density and good charge-discharge cycle capability, they have been widely used in mobile phones, notebook computers, electric vehicles and other fields. Lithium ion batteries have been widely used in people's daily life due to their high energy density and long cycle life, but various battery safety problems occur frequently, so battery safety problems are gradually valued, and more and more researches on improving battery safety are carried out.
[0003] The safety problem caused by battery thermal runaway is mainly because when the battery is under high load such as high power and large current, or the battery is used in a relatively harsh environment such as high temperature, a large amount of heat will often be generated inside the battery, and the battery temperature will further rise. When the battery temperature cannot be inhibited or eliminated, the chemical system inside the battery will further deteriorate, and the internal material will be damaged, thereby causing thermal runaway, and further causing accidents such as fire and explosion of the battery. [0067] First specific embodiment
[0068] The battery provided by the first specific embodiment of the present application comprises a battery cell and a safety assembly. Please refer to Figure 1 The safety assembly comprises at least one resistance member 1 and at least one first temperature switch 2, the resistance member 1 and the first temperature switch 2 are connected in series and located between a first electrode 31 and a second electrode 32 of a battery cell body 3, and constitute a discharge circuit. Wherein:
[0069] The battery cell comprises the battery cell body 3, and the first electrode 31 and the second electrode 32 extending from the battery cell body 3, the polarities of the first electrode 31 and the second electrode 32 are opposite (if the first electrode 31 is a positive electrode, the second electrode 32 is a negative electrode; if the first electrode 31 is a negative electrode, the second electrode 32 is a positive electrode);
[0070] The resistance member 1 comprises a first connecting portion 11, a main body portion 13 and a second connecting portion 12 connected in sequence, the first connecting portion 11 is electrically connected with the first electrode 31 of the battery cell;
[0071] The first temperature switch 2 comprises a shell 26, a first pin 21 and a second pin 27 extending out of the shell 26, and a first temperature control 23 located in the shell 26. The part of the first pin 21 extending out of the shell 26 is used to be electrically connected with the second connecting part 12 of the resistance element 1, and the part of the first pin 21 located in the shell 26 is provided with a first conductive connecting element 22 (which can be an electric contact piece in particular). The part of the second pin 27 extending out of the shell 26 is used to be electrically connected with the second electrode 32 of the battery cell, and the part of the second pin 27 located in the shell 26 is provided with a second conductive connecting element 24 (which can be an electric contact cantilever in particular). The first temperature control 23 is used to control whether the first conductive connecting element 22 and the second conductive connecting element 24 are in communication. (Or in other embodiments, the second pin 27 extending out of the shell 26 can be electrically connected with the second connecting part 12 of the resistance element 1, and the first pin 21 extending out of the shell 26 can be electrically connected with the second electrode 32 of the battery cell.)
[0072] During the use of the battery:
[0073] Please refer to Figure 6 When the temperature of the first temperature control 23 is not greater than the first preset temperature T1, the first temperature control 23 is in the second state. At this time, the first temperature control 23 supports the second conductive connecting element 24 to make the second conductive connecting element 24 away from the first conductive connecting element 22, realizing the disconnection between the first pin 21 and the second pin 27, so that the first temperature switch 2 is disconnected, and the circuit in which the first temperature switch 2 and the resistance element 1 are located is disconnected.
[0074] Please refer to Figure 5 When the temperature of the first temperature control 23 is greater than the first preset temperature T1, the first temperature control 23 is in the first state. At this time, the first temperature control 23 has no supporting force (or small supporting force) on the second conductive connecting element 24, so that the second conductive connecting element 24 can be electrically connected with the first conductive connecting element 22 under the action of its own pre-stress, so that the first temperature switch 2 is closed, the first electrode 31 and the second electrode 32 of the battery cell are conducted through the first temperature switch 2 and the resistance element 1, and the battery is discharged through the resistance element 1.
[0075] It can be seen that the first temperature switch 2 is a normally open temperature switch, and the trigger temperature thereof is the first preset temperature T1. When the temperature of the environment in which the first temperature switch 2 is located is lower than the trigger temperature, the first temperature switch 2 remains in the disconnected state, and when the temperature is higher than the trigger temperature, the first temperature switch 2 is closed. In some embodiments, the value range of the first preset temperature T1 satisfies T2≤T1≤T3, T2 is the highest temperature at which the battery can normally work, and T3 is the lowest temperature at which the battery occurs thermal runaway.
[0076] The first temperature switch 2 can timely sense the change of ambient temperature and automatically control the first temperature switch 2 to open at high temperature environment, so that the battery is discharged and heat is dissipated to the outside through the resistance element 1, thereby avoiding the thermal runaway of the battery at high temperature environment and improving the safety of the battery. When the ambient temperature decreases to the safety range, the first temperature control 23 automatically returns to the original state, and the first temperature switch 2 is automatically disconnected, and the discharge between the positive and negative electrodes of the battery is stopped.
[0077] Further, the safety assembly can further include a second temperature switch, which is a normally closed temperature switch. When the temperature is lower than the trigger temperature, the second temperature switch remains in the closed state. When the temperature is higher than the trigger temperature, the second temperature switch is disconnected.
[0078] The trigger temperature of the second temperature switch is higher than that of the first temperature switch 2. The second temperature switch is connected in series with the first temperature switch 2. The second temperature switch further includes a second temperature control. When the temperature of the second temperature control is greater than a second preset temperature T4, the second temperature control is in a third state and controls the second temperature switch to be disconnected. When the temperature of the second temperature control is lower than the second preset temperature T4 (T4>T1), the second temperature control is in a fourth state and controls the second temperature switch to be closed. In specific implementation, T3≤T4≤T3+T5, T3 is the lowest temperature at which the battery occurs thermal runaway, and T5 can be any value in the range of 20℃ to 100℃. For example, T5 can be any value in the range of 21℃, 25℃, 30℃, 35℃, 40℃, 45℃, 50℃, 55℃, 60℃, 65℃, 70℃, 75℃, 80℃, 85℃, 90℃, 95℃.
[0079] Therefore, when the external environment temperature is too high, for example, the temperature of the second temperature switch and the second temperature control inside the second temperature switch reaches or is higher than T4, the discharge circuit is disconnected through the second temperature switch, and the discharge circuit is closed again when the temperature of the resistance element 1 decreases. When the external environment temperature is higher than T1 and lower than T4, the first temperature switch 2 and the second temperature switch are both in the closed state, and the discharge circuit is kept conducting. Therefore, intermittent discharge and heat dissipation are formed, which can avoid the thermal runaway of the battery due to the too high external environment temperature and avoid the safety hazard caused by the too high temperature of the resistance element 1.

[0085] In some embodiments, the resistance member 1 in the battery provided by the present application is an integrally formed structural member made of the same material, i.e. the first connecting part 11, the second connecting part 12 and the main body part 13 of the resistance member 1 are integrally formed and connected.
[0086] Or in other embodiments, the first connecting part 11 and the second connecting part 12 of the resistance member 1 can be respectively external connecting leads welded or bonded or connected through fasteners with the main body part 13.
[0087] Alternatively, the first connecting part 11, the main body part 13 and the second connecting part 12 are arranged in a stacked manner, i.e. the resistance member 1 is a Figure 4 multi-layer structure as shown in the above-mentioned drawings. For example, the resistance member 1 is a heating resistance in a sheet structure, and the material can be a metal material or a carbon material that can play a role in electric conduction and heat dissipation. The metal material is preferably stainless steel, aluminum, aluminum alloy, nickel, nickel alloy, and the carbon material is preferably graphite, graphene, carbon nanotube.
[0088] In some embodiments, the main body part 13 of the resistance member 1 is a polygonal panel structure, i.e. the resistance member 1 is a Figure 1The diagram shows a single-piece plate structure without holes, grooves, or perforations. Alternatively, in other embodiments, the main body 13 of the resistor 1 can be a thin sheet structure with one or more slits, and the ohmic impedance of the resistor 1 can be adjusted by the shape and area of the slits. In specific implementations, the slits on the main body 13 can be obtained by mechanical punching, laser cutting, chemical etching, or electrochemical etching.
[0089] It should be noted that the gap on the main body 13 refers to the hollow structure in the form of a channel or groove on the surface of the main body 13 of the resistor 1. The channel can be a through hole, a countersunk hole or other hole of any shape, and the shape of the channel or groove can be straight, arc or other arbitrary shape.
[0090] For example, the main body 13 is composed of Figure 2 The concave shape shown, or Figure 3 , Figure 18 , Figure 19 , Figure 20 The snake-like shape shown. Alternatively, in other embodiments, the channels or grooves on the surface of the main body 13 can be designed in other shapes, such as... Figure 21 The holes or grooves shown are distributed throughout the main body 13.
[0091] Among them, such as Figure 3 as well as Figures 18 to 20 As shown, the main body 13 of the resistor 1 includes a first groove 1310 and a second groove 1320 arranged at intervals. The main body 13 includes a first side 131 and a second side 132 disposed opposite to each other. The first groove 1310 extends from the first side 131 toward the second side 132, and the distance between the inner wall surface of the first groove 1310 and the second side 132 is greater than zero. The second groove 1320 extends from the second side 132 toward the first side 131, and the distance between the inner wall surface of the second groove 1320 and the first side 131 is greater than zero.
[0092] In specific implementations, the gap width of the aforementioned channels or grooves can be any value within the range of 10μm to 15mm, preferably any value within the range of 100μm to 1mm. For example, in some embodiments, the gap width in the aforementioned hollow structure can be designed as any value among 10μm, 20μm, 30μm, 40μm, 50μm, 60μm, 70μm, 80μm, 90μm, 100μm, 200μm, 300μm, 400μm, 500μm, 600μm, 700μm, 800μm, 900μm, 1mm, 2mm, 3mm, 4mm, 5mm, and 10mm.
[0093] The hollow structure can increase the ohmic impedance of the main body 13. It is known that the more the holes or grooves on the main body 13, the larger the hollow area, and the higher the impedance of the resistor 1. By reasonably setting the gap width and length of each position in the hollow structure, the heating power of the resistor 1 can be kept within an optimal range.
[0094] Further, the hollow structure is provided with an insulating member, which can be an insulating adhesive tape or insulating adhesive applied in the hollow structure formed by the holes or grooves of the resistor 1. In specific implementation, the material of the insulating member is preferably at least one of a polymer and a ceramic. The polymer is preferably PVDF (Polyvinylidene fluoride), PMMA (Polymethylmethacrylate, also known as acrylic or organic glass), polyimide, epoxy resin, or silica gel.
[0095] In some embodiments, the resistor 1 (especially the main body 13) can be any one of a sheet resistor, a resistive coating, a plated metal layer, or a chemically deposited metal layer.
[0096] In some embodiments, the thickness of the main body 13 of the resistor 1 is d, and 1 μm≤d≤2 mm, for example, d=2 μm or 4 μm or 5 μm or 10 μm or 15 μm or 20 μm or 25 μm or 30 μm or 40 μm or 45 μm or 50 μm or 100 μm or 200 μm or 300 μm or 400 μm or 500 μm or 600 μm or 700 μm or 800 μm or 900 μm or 1 mm or 1.5 mm. Preferably, d is any value in the range of 3 μm to 20 μm.

[0103] Please refer to Figure 11 In some embodiments, an insulating layer 4 is arranged between the main body 13 and the outer surface of the battery core body 3. The insulating layer 4 comprises at least one of a polymer and an inorganic ceramic, and the material of the insulating layer 4 has a thermal conductivity coefficient of 0.01-0.9 W / (m·K), which can prevent the heat generated by the resistance element 1 from heating the battery core body, thereby further improving the safety performance.
[0104] Further, in some embodiments, the insulating layer 4 can also have a bonding effect, and its material comprises an adhesive, which can bond the battery core body 3 and the resistance element 1 in the sheet structure together, and the bonding force is ≥0.1 N / m, for example, the adhesive of the insulating layer 4 is a polymer material.
[0105] Alternatively, in some embodiments, the insulating layer 4 can also comprise a heat-absorbing material, such as a phase change heat-absorbing material or a chemical heat-absorbing material, thereby further improving the safety performance of the battery. It should be noted that the heat-absorbing material refers to a material that can effectively absorb and release heat, or in other words, a material that can absorb heat when the temperature rises and release heat when the temperature drops. They usually have high specific heat capacity or latent heat characteristics, can effectively store and release heat within a certain temperature range, and can maintain stable performance in multiple heat absorption and release cycles without aging or failure.
[0106] Specifically, when the temperature of the battery core body 3 is high, the insulating layer 4 can absorb heat and conduct the heat to the main body 13 and the surrounding air, thereby playing a certain heat dissipation effect on the battery core body 3; when the temperature of the main body 13 is high, the insulating layer 4 can absorb the heat of the main body 13, avoiding the direct transmission of the heat of the main body 13 to the battery core body 3, thereby playing a certain heat insulation effect between the main body 13 and the battery core body 3 through the insulating layer 4, avoiding the heating of the main body 13 to the battery core body 3. In specific implementation, the insulating layer 4 can be any heat-absorbing material such as paraffin, fatty acid, polyethylene glycol, polyethylene, polyethylene wax, polypropylene, or the insulating layer 4 can also be any heat-absorbing and heat-conducting adhesive such as epoxy resin-based, silicone-based, polyurethane-based, and acrylic-based.
[0107] In some embodiments, the relationship between the DC internal resistance R0 of the battery cell body 3 under full charge and at 25°C, the ohmic impedance R1 of the first temperature switch 2, and the ohmic impedance R2 of the sheet-structure resistor 1 satisfies: 2(R0+R1)≤R2≤1000(R0+R1), where R1 is any value within the range of 1 to 100Ω, and the units of R0, R1, and R2 are all mΩ. In some embodiments, the battery capacity is set to Q (unit: mAh), the DC internal resistance DCIR of the battery under full charge and at 25°C is set to R0 (unit: mΩ), the ohmic impedance of the first temperature switch 2 is set to R1 (unit: mΩ), and the ohmic impedance of the sheet-structure resistor 1 is set to R2 (unit: mΩ). Then, the optimal relationship between R2 and Q satisfies: Q(R0+R1) / 5000≤R2≤5000(R0+R1). For example, in some embodiments, R2 is any value within the range of 0.2Ω to 5Ω. If R2 is too small, it will easily lead to a large amount of heat generation in a short period of time, causing the battery to heat up quickly and fail; if R2 is too large, it will not discharge sufficiently in a short period of time, failing to reduce the battery energy, and the battery will still easily fail at high temperatures.

[0109] Second specific embodiment
[0110] like Figure 7 and Figure 8 As shown, in the second specific embodiment, the first temperature control element 23 in the first temperature switch 2 is an arc-shaped structure with both ends being free, located between the second conductive connector 24 and the first conductive connector 22. Furthermore, the contact area 231 of the first temperature control element 23 is located at the apex of the arc-shaped area in its middle region, and the shape of the first temperature control element 23 changes with temperature. For example:
[0111] When the ambient temperature is high enough to reach the trigger temperature of the first temperature switch 2, the first temperature control 23 is in the first state (see [reference]). Figure 7 The first temperature control 23 bends toward the side where the second conductive connector 24 is located, and the two ends of the first temperature control 23 are away from the second conductive connector 24 and are located in the groove on the inner wall of the housing 26, thereby controlling the second conductive connector 24 to contact the first conductive connector 22, and the first temperature switch 2 closes.
[0112] When the ambient temperature is lower than the trigger temperature of the first temperature switch 2, the first temperature control 23 is in the second state (see [reference]). Figure 8), the first temperature control 23 is bent towards the side where the first conductive connecting piece 22 is located, the two ends of the first temperature control 23 are raised and support the second conductive connecting piece 24, thereby controlling the second conductive connecting piece 24 to move away from the first conductive connecting piece 22, and the first temperature switch 2 is disconnected.
[0113] Third embodiment
[0114] As shown in Figure 9 and Figure 10 , in the third embodiment, the first temperature control 23 in the first temperature switch 2 is in an arc-shaped structure, and is located on the side where the second conductive connecting piece 24 faces away from the first conductive connecting piece 22. Moreover, the abutting area 231 of the first temperature control 23 is located at the end, and the bending degree of the first temperature control 23 changes with the temperature. For example:
[0115] When the ambient temperature is high and reaches the trigger temperature of the first temperature switch 2, the first temperature control 23 is in the first state (see Figure 9 ), the bending degree of the first temperature control 23 is large, thereby extruding the second conductive connecting piece 24 to contact the first conductive connecting piece 22, at this time, the first temperature switch 2 is in a closed state;
[0116] When the ambient temperature is lower than the trigger temperature of the first temperature switch 2, the first temperature control 23 is in the second state (see Figure 10 ), the bending degree of the first temperature control 23 is small, and the abutting area 231 thereof moves slightly in the direction away from the second conductive connecting piece 24, thereby the second conductive connecting piece 24 moves away from the first conductive connecting piece 22 under the action of the elastic restoring force thereof, at this time, the first temperature switch 2 is in a disconnected state.

[0127] Embodiments 14 to 16
[0128] Compared with the above embodiment 10, the difference between embodiments 14 to 16 is only that the trigger temperature of the first temperature switch 2 is different. Among them, the trigger temperature of the first temperature switch 2 in embodiments 14 to 16 is 75℃, 95℃, 105℃ respectively.
[0129] From the test results in the above table, it can be seen that the lower the trigger temperature of the first temperature switch 2, the higher the pass rate of the battery in the hot box safety test process. In order to make the battery adapt to a higher temperature environment as much as possible, the trigger temperature of the first temperature switch 2 is best set in the range of 75℃ to 85℃ during specific implementation, and in some cases, for example, when the environmental temperature is not higher than 130℃, the trigger temperature of the first temperature switch 2 can also be set to any value within the range of 85℃ to 105℃.
[0130] Comparative example 1
[0131] The difference of Comparative Example 1 compared to Examples 1 to 16 above is that the battery does not contain the safety assembly described above, i.e. no first temperature switch 2 and resistor 1 are arranged between the positive and negative electrode tabs of the cell.
[0132] From the test results in the above table, it can be seen that arranging the safety assembly consisting of a temperature switch and a resistor 1 between the positive and negative electrode tabs of the cell can effectively improve the pass rate of the thermal chamber safety test of the battery.
